Abstract
The Bond and the Hardgrove methods are widely used for the determination of the material?s grindability. Generally, the determination of the Bond work index of inhomogeneous materials can be carried out with high deviation using the conventional apparatuses and methods, because of the highly different grindability of components. This is more significant when the composite cement?s grindability is measured, which highly affects the design and operation of cement grinding mills. A possible solution can be the combined application of the Bond-method with the determination of the component?s weight ratio in the product and perform the Bond measurement until the steady state conditions of grindability coefficient (G) and chemical composition of the components are reached. To prove the applicability of the above mentioned idea systematic Bond and Hardgrove grindability tests were carried out of two phase composite materials. The experimental results showed that the application of the combined procedure is proven in order to have a more accurate and reliable calculation of the Bond work index of composite materials, especially when the components have significant difference in the grindability and concentration. The measurements also showed the possibilities and limits of the grindability test methods.
